Subject: [PATCH v2] xfs: add FALLOC_FL_ALLOCATE_RANGE to supported flags mask

Add FALLOC_FL_ALLOCATE_RANGE to the set of supported fallocate flags in
XFS_FALLOC_FL_SUPPORTED. This change improves code clarity and maintains
by explicitly showing this flag in the supported flags mask.

Note that since FALLOC_FL_ALLOCATE_RANGE is defined as 0x00, this addition
has no functional modifications.

diff --git a/fs/xfs/xfs_file.c b/fs/xfs/xfs_file.c
index 48254a72071b..0b41b18debf3 100644
--- a/fs/xfs/xfs_file.c
+++ b/fs/xfs/xfs_file.c
@@ -1335,9 +1335,10 @@ xfs_falloc_allocate_range(
 }
 
 #define	XFS_FALLOC_FL_SUPPORTED						\
-		(FALLOC_FL_KEEP_SIZE | FALLOC_FL_PUNCH_HOLE |		\
-		 FALLOC_FL_COLLAPSE_RANGE | FALLOC_FL_ZERO_RANGE |	\
-		 FALLOC_FL_INSERT_RANGE | FALLOC_FL_UNSHARE_RANGE)
+		(FALLOC_FL_ALLOCATE_RANGE | FALLOC_FL_KEEP_SIZE |	\
+		 FALLOC_FL_PUNCH_HOLE |	FALLOC_FL_COLLAPSE_RANGE |	\
+		 FALLOC_FL_ZERO_RANGE |	FALLOC_FL_INSERT_RANGE |	\
+		 FALLOC_FL_UNSHARE_RANGE)
 
 STATIC long
 __xfs_file_fallocate(
